Output 034bff1741e5e99da713e4a594f9e3e67233eec1af9f285d2cfe6914b7928b53:9

value
25166068
script pubkey
OP_0 OP_PUSHBYTES_20 babddd2f85d44f199e4cf68697e1b5a7dd58700f
address
ltc1qh27a6tu96383n8jv76rf0cd45lw4suq0mg2e3z
transaction
034bff1741e5e99da713e4a594f9e3e67233eec1af9f285d2cfe6914b7928b53
spent
true